Throughout calendar year 2006, the Technology Division has gone through a transformation to better serve the Industry and the Board. The Division is now aligned in four operating groups; Games Approvals, System Approvals, Field Services and Information Technology Operations. This is the Gaming Control Board's policy regarding wireless gaming devices. These policies should be considered when submitting a system based game with a wireless client. This policy is to be used in conjunction with Nevada Gaming Regulation 14 and all applicable Regulation 14 Technical Standards ( 1 - 4). Please note that there may be accounting and reporting requirements published at a later date.
